Tip 1: Lime moisture absorption bag
Usually we can also make a homemade lime moisture absorption bag in the bathroom to help the tiles prevent moisture, but it should be noted that quicklime should be used, not building lime. Take a few quicklime powder, wrap it in a cotton cloth or cloth bag of moderate size, sew the mouth, hang the small cloth bag with a rope, and hang it in a relatively humid place.
Tips 2: Coffee ground water absorption pack
Coffee grounds have both water absorption and deodorization functions. Collect coffee grounds, dry them and wrap them in gauze bags, stockings or cotton socks, and place them in every corner of the floor to effectively absorb moisture from the air. For newly installed floors, it also has the function of removing formaldehyde and other decoration pollution odors. It can be said to be the healthiest dehumidifier.
Tips 3: The magical use of air conditioners
In addition to dehumidifiers, air conditioners are also "experts" in dehumidification. Everyone should know that ordinary air conditioners have a dehumidification function, because air conditioners will inevitably be accompanied by dehumidification during the refrigeration process.
